Mitsubishi Electric Power Products, Inc. (MEPPI) is seeking a Quality Assurance Engineer II. This position willlead and coordinate quality improvement activities for the Switchgear Division by analyzing quality issues, identifying root causes, and driving corrective action implementation. Manage and support the Quality Management System (QMS), ensuring effective quality assurance processes and ongoing compliance with ISO 9001 requirements.

What You'll Do:
  • Support and lead root cause investigations for production, process, or field issues to support divisional goals.
  • Support and lead corrective action development and implementation for production, process and field quality issues. Verify effectiveness of implemented corrective actions to improve quality performance.
  • Lead work with Switchgear Division departments to develop 5-WHY and Failure Mode and Effects Analyses (FMEA's) problem solving techniques for divisional needs.
  • Review, trend and closeout nonconformities and incidents on time and as required.
  • Assist Engineering and Production personnel to identify design problems.
  • Collaborate with suppliers, incoming inspection, in-process inspection, production and engineering to resolve in-process product assembly problems.
  • Participate in and/or lead internal audits upon request. Work with all departments to help close audit findings in an effective and timely manner.
  • Coordinate continued evaluation of procedures and documentation throughout Switchgear Division. Verify completeness, accuracy, and lack of redundancy.
  • Facilitate in-house quality assurance and manufacturing improvement programs throughout Switchgear Division.
  • Analyze field service reports and identify trends to develop preventative action plans.
  • Travel to customer or supplier locations to audit, analyze and remedy quality problems.
  • Assure quality records are generated, retained, stored, protected and disposed according to Switchgear Division and Company policies.
  • Ability to travel domestically and internationally up to 15% of the time as required.

*The description above represents the most significant and essential duties of the job but does not exclude other occasional work assignments not mentioned.

What You'll Bring:
  • Bachelor's Degree in Engineering or related technical field with 3-5 years of experience in quality control and/or assurance function, or equivalent education and experience.
  • Intermediate knowledge of ISO-9001, Quality Assurance and manufacturing improvement practices such as Lean and Six Sigma.
  • Advanced knowledge of quality techniques such as Statistical Process Control (SPC), Deming Methods, 5-WHY, 8DS, etc.
  • Advanced interpersonal communication and presentation skills required to communicate with employees, vendors, and customers.
  • Advanced computer skills with emphasis on MS Office products and MRP/ERP systems.
